American Capitalism

So, tomorrow is July 4th, what a better time to talk about good ole American Capitalism at work here in the nation's capital. There is an annual tradition right about this time every year in the district. It is a bicycle parade? No. Is it BBQs? No. Is it finding new and exciting ways to hide alcohol on the Mall? No. Although all those things happen, I"m talking about the fireworks stands that spring up overnight roadside in many, many locations around DC. Also, large banners appear outside stores hawking fireworks. How is this American Capitalism at work? Well, fireworks are pretty much illegal in DC. You can have those snaps and sparklers and coloured lights, but beyond it, "Firecrackers of any kind or description" are prohibited. But in the great American way, there's a demand for illegal fireworks, there will be a supply so someone can make some ill-gotten money. Today I was out buying some lunch and I passed by a banner that promoted Freedom Fireworks. So, as I was buying my freedom fries and eating my freedom toast during the war, post-war, I can now buy illegal freedom fireworks to celebrate. God Bless America.
